Programme specification:
At the end of the programme, students should:
- have developed a sound knowledge and skills base in the core areas of the discipline of computing;
- have developed a specialist knowledge and skills base in specified areas of Computer Science;
- have developed a specialist knowledge and skills base in specified areas of Mathematics;
- be prepared for graduate careers in the IT industry and other contexts where high quality mathematical skills are required;
- be prepared for further study either in the context of Continuing Professional Development or through further engagement in Higher Education.
